Jim Rodenbush, who has been fired as director of student media at Indiana University, reacts to receiving a standing ovation here at #MediaFest25. Jim’s ouster this week came amid growing tension between the school and the student newspaper over what content was allowed in the print edition.

Media executive, author and professor Chris R. Vaccaro is the Society of Professional Journalists’ 109th national president.
Vaccaro was sworn in during the Presidents Reception today at #MediaFest25 in Washington, D.C.
